S is for SPLIT. Income splitting is a strategy that involves transferring a portion of greenbacks from someone is actually in a high tax bracket to a person who is in the lower tax segment. It may even be possible to reduce the tax on the transferred income to zero if this person, doesn't possess any other taxable income. Normally, the other person is either your spouse or common-law spouse, but it could even be your children. Whenever it is possible to transfer income to someone in a lower tax bracket, it must be done. If major difference between tax rates is 20% your own family will save $200 for every $1,000 transferred into the "lower rate" relation.
